Clogged Gutter Clearing in Long Island, NY
Clogged gutter cl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t that can block the flow of water through a property's gutter system. These projects typically include inspecting gutters for obstructions, safely removing buildup, and ensuring that downspouts are clear to prevent water from overflowing or causing damage to the roof, siding, or foundation. Homeowners often request this service to protect their property from water-related issues, especially after storms or during seasons with heavy leaf fall, helping to maintain proper drainage and prevent costly repairs.

Clogged Gutter Clearing Questions
What causes gutters to become clogged? Leaves, twigs, and debris from nearby trees often block gutters, preventing proper water flow during rain.
How can clogged gutters affect a home? Overflowing or backed-up gutters can lead to water damage, foundation issues, and roof problems over time.
What are signs of a clogged gutter? Water spilling over the sides, sagging gutters, or visible debris are common indicators of blockage.
Why should clogged gutters be cleared regularly? Routine cleaning helps prevent water damage, pest infestations, and maintains proper drainage around the property.
